AES Clean Energy is seeking a highly technical NERC CIP Compliance Senior Technical Auditor to provide leadership, independent oversight, and expert guidance in maintaining continuous compliance with the NERC CIP Standards that support the reliable operation of the Bulk Electric System. This role requires a strong technical foundation in cybersecurity, operational technology, and control system environments, along with the ability to perform detailed technical assessments, validate complex security controls, and interpret technical evidence with precision. Primary Duties and Responsibilities
  • Demonstrate deep expertise in applicable NERC CIP Standards (CIP-002 through CIP-014).
  • Maintain strong technical knowledge of NERC compliance monitoring and enforcement processes.
  • Clearly and concisely communicate NERC compliance requirements, standards, and expectations to Subject Matter Experts (SMEs).
  • Conduct periodic internal compliance assessments and spot checks to verify adherence to applicable Standards.
  • Monitor updates to new and existing CIP Standards, and coordinate comments from internal SMEs for industry commenting and balloting activities.
